When you look toward the draft later this month, several Oregon players will be headed to the NFL, certainly among them is Former Duck Dion Jordan. This video is pretty impressive as far as showing off his speed and agility on the field.

HUB Video:  ESPN SportsScience: Dion Jordan

The ESPN Sports Science Series does some pretty cool things. It breaks things down even further than his performance during the NFL Combine and shows you numbers that you wouldn’t normally see. His speed when he accelerates is amazing to me. In the video he gets to 16 miles per hour in just three steps…yeah, you read that right….three steps.

Jordan is also ranked throughout the video versus several other athletes that did the ESPN Performance test this year and in some areas he is ranked pretty high. Ultimately we know he will play on Sunday’s somewhere, and we also know from the video that if the opposing Offensive line can’t contain him in about 4 seconds…their Quarterback may need some help getting peeled from the turf.

Several projections have Jordan heading to Philadelphia to join former coach Chip Kelly, another has him headed to Jacksonville. We’ll know for sure in a few weeks. From the looks of it, wherever he lands he will be a playmaker.
